Hi,

Do you have children? On rare occasion they will allow your other half to come back home by asking you to place cameras in your home. I don't personally have children so I cant even imagine how difficult it must be to go through this with your children. Sending you lots of hugs. I know that it is invasive but at the same time it is good that they are willing to let your partner live with you if that is also what you want. In most cases, in fact around 90% time they don't. It takes years for them to say yes.


I would personally not recommend discussing it with them. They will think that you are siding with your other half and not seeing the danger. And they will deem you unfit to supervise your children. Remember, they see your other half as a danger to children. And they definitely want to see that you can understand what he is capable of and that you are capable of protecting your children.
